GeForce RTX 5080 vs Radeon RX 9070 XT: In-Depth Breakdown
Performance: GeForce RTX 5080 vs Radeon RX 9070 XT
The GeForce RTX 5080 is noticeably faster, around 11% ahead of the Radeon RX 9070 XT. Both cards sit in the same broad class, well suited to 4K and high-refresh 1440p.
Power & Efficiency
At 304W against 360W, the Radeon RX 9070 XT is both the lower-power and the more efficient card, making it the easier build to cool and power.
Features & Ecosystem
Beyond raw numbers, the GeForce RTX 5080 brings NVIDIA DLSS upscaling/frame generation and stronger ray tracing, while the Radeon RX 9070 XT offers AMD FSR upscaling and strong rasterization value. If you lean on upscaling or ray tracing, that ecosystem difference can matter as much as the frame-rate gap.
